What is $608,241 After Taxes in Hawaii?
A $608,241 salary in Hawaii takes home $346,362 after federal income tax, state income tax, and FICA — a 43.1% effective tax rate.
Annual Take-Home Pay
$346,362
after $261,879 in total taxes (43.1% effective rate)

Hawaii Tax Overview
Hawaii applies a top marginal income tax rate of 11.0% on the highest earners. The graduated bracket structure means most middle-income earners face effective state rates well below the headline number.
